On Thu, 8 Feb 2001, David Weinehall wrote: > > Well, after all, it's debugging code, and the code now is easy to read. > Your code, while more efficient, isn't. I think that clarity takes > priority over efficiency in non-critical code such as debugging > code. Of course, this is my personal opinion...
I agree my version isn't _as_ easy, and if this code only got built into DEBUG kernels, I would never have bothered about it; but it's built into every kernel, on executed paths, so it's no less critical.
